Isolation of {beta}-sitosterol, Phytol and Zingerone 4-O-{beta}-D-glucopyranoside from Chrysanthemum Boreale Makino

Abstract
|
|
|
The flowers of Chrysanthemum boreale Makino were extracted with 80% aqueous MeOH, and the concentrated extract was partitioned with n-hexane, EtOAc, n-BuOH and H_2O. Two compounds from the n-hexane fraction and one glucoside from the n-BuOH fraction were isolated through the repeated silica gel and ODS column chromatographies. From the result of physico-chemical data including NMR, MS and IR, the chemical structures of the compounds were determined as {beta}-sitosterol (1), phytol (2) and zingerone 4-O-{beta}-D-glucopyranoside (3). Compounds 2 and 3 were isolated for the first time from this plant.
